NOT guilty pleas have been entered by a Henley man accused of sexually assaulting a woman.

Matthew Eggleton, of Luker Avenue, Henley, appeared at Oxford Crown Court on Thursday (August 1) charged with two counts.

He has been charged with assaulting a female 13 and over by penetration as well as one count of assaulting a person thereby occasioning them actual bodily harm.

The 35-year-old is accused of committing these offences on March 14, March 16 and March 28, 2021 against the same woman.

He appeared at the higher court for his plea and trial preparation hearing in front of Judge Ian Pringle.

Wearing a suit and spotted tie, Eggleton denied the offences.

A trial date has been set for August 11 next year.

Eggleton could be heard scoffing and shaking his head upon hearing the trial date.
